American railroad magnate, merchant, philanthropist and abolitionist (1813–1898)
John Murray Forbes was an American railroad magnate, merchant, opium merchant, philanthropist and abolitionist. He was president of both the Michigan Central railroad and the Chicago, Burlington and Quincy Railroad in the 1850s. He kept doing business with Russell & Company.
